I've been casting around looking for a new project and thought I might like to give the "Minnie" traction engine a go. The snag is that the book by Leonard Mason is jaw droppingly expensive. It's no longer published and second hand ones go for upwards of $US100.

It was published by Model & Allied Publications (MAP) which over the years has morphed into Special Interest Model Books Ltd. I E-mailed them and asked if they would consider publishing it again. I received the following reply:

"We don’t have any plans to republish that particular title and in any case I would not know how to reach the author in order to clear the rights."

If anyone knows where Leonard Mason or his literary heirs are, you may wish to contact them and suggest they look at republication. Given the high price the used copies command, there's obviously a demand for it.
